★ 5★ 4★ 3★ 2★ 1My husband and I had such a good experience with Brandon of Louisiana Dance Roots. We did a private dance lesson as a fun date night at the Dance Quarter in New Orleans! He started off with an introduction of what Cajun dance meant to him and how he learned this form of dance. We learned the two step, the Waltz, and practiced turns. They were simple moves that gave us a good foundation to practice at home. During our lesson he serenaded with the accordion, which was unexpected. We loved it! He would regularly stop and check to get feedback and answer any questions. We appreciated his relaxed approach and look forward to future lessons and classes with him. If you’re thinking about doing lessons, I would highly recommend. We had so much fun!
